High Definition Printing (HDP®) Technology
Prints over the edge on cards with superior image clarity and true color rendering.
Fast Throughput – 230 Cards/Hour
Industry-leading speed: full-color, dual-sided printing with optional lamination in just 6 seconds/card.
Modular & Scalable Design
Add features like dual input hoppers, lamination, Wi-Fi, and multiple encoding modules as needed.
Smart Card & Contactless Encoding
Supports HID iCLASS®, MIFARE®, DESFire®, and magnetic stripe encoding.
GreenCircle® Certified Energy Efficiency
Reduced power consumption and rapid warm-up contribute to lower total cost of ownership.
Advanced Security Features
Includes resin data masking, password protection, and secure printing controls.
High-Resolution Retransfer Printing
Produces superior 600 dpi edge-to-edge prints with sharp details, vibrant colors, and excellent durability.
Integrated Lamination for Enhanced Security
Offers single or dual-sided lamination with holographic overlays and protective films to prevent counterfeiting and wear.
High-Speed, High-Volume Printing
Prints up to 140 single-sided laminated cards per hour, making it ideal for organizations with large-scale card issuance needs.
Advanced Security Encoding Options
Supports magnetic stripe, smart card, and RFID encoding to enhance data protection and card functionality.
Rugged and Durable Design
Built for continuous use in demanding environments, ensuring long-term performance and reliability.
Eco-Friendly and Cost-Effective Operation
Minimizes waste with optimized lamination film usage and low energy consumption for a sustainable printing solution.
